那个……我可能要打击你一下了……不过这些的确是我看你文章的感受

首先,从心得和用词上,是看得出你颇下一番功夫的。但是,这些过于花俏的词却用得不够得当,颇有过犹不及的感觉。从你通篇的用词和行文来看,我会觉得你是英语写作本来不是十分扎实,却以为一定要砸大词才好,所以去钻研成了现在这样。这些大词和你的say,remember这样口语化的词凑合在一起,真的很不协调。它们都是高分作文里出现的词,但是很难混搭来用。语法也是同理的,你句子绕得程度真的已经到了我要把从句拆掉先看句子结构的程度——并且拆完了要么就是不对,要么是对,但是很别扭。如果你有时间,我建议你先把从句的语法和虚拟语态再过一遍,如果你快要考试了,那么我会劝你干脆不要用。
至于去有意消除重复,去找红宝书的词,更是不必。看看范文里,难道没有重复?

其次,关于文章结构的问题,我先归纳一下你的段落大意吧:
1、总起:教授出去工作是有益教学的,但主动权应该掌握在师生手上
2、教授出去工作是有益教学的
3、但是,不是所有学科的教授都适合出去工作
4、另外,教授出去工作会影响个人精力
5、而且,教授工作后可能跳槽,造成人才流失
6、综合而言,学校应该如何做
7、工作经验不是影响教学质量的主要指标
这样看着是可以的,但你觉不觉得呼应不足?我觉得你后来就忘了你一开始的“主动权应该掌握在师生手上”,转而变成“如何防止跳槽”,所以整体结构就值得商榷
另外这个归纳的是我认为的你的本意,不是说你的文章有效地表达出来的观点,因为你的局部论证也不够有说服力
但是这个整体结构问题和局部结构问题是二而一的,就是老美写文章的思路:只有一个论点。
我觉得我们中国人写文章想得比较多,我们会在一篇文章里发展出很多观点,并且层层深入,最后升华,但是,再说一遍,尤其是Issue里,我们只要一个论点。
分论点必须为总论点服务,小论据必须为分论点服务。(这是我觉得在备战二战AW里才领悟到的至理)
这样你看看你的文章,教授跳槽和主动权应该掌握在师生手上的关系是什么?——没有关系,这就不对。
老美的逻辑就是,教授出去工作是有益教学的,但主动权应该掌握在师生手上,因为一、二、三点理由。第一理由是成立的,因为1、2、3论据……
这样全文只有一个论点,你会发现你的文章呼应,起承转合都容易很多。至于要不要放例子,放什么例子,也更容易决定。

看完这篇文章,我真是后悔没有早点批改。
问题太严重了:不能把issue当作argument写!!!(第一次在批改中用红字)
issue问的是你对这件事的观点,而不是你对这句话的观点。多读读官方的指南。
